stableness
English Thesaurus
1. the quality or attribute of being firm and steadfast (noun.attribute)
| hypernym | : | firmness, steadiness, |
| definition | : | the quality of being steady or securely and immovably fixed in place (noun.attribute) |
| antonym | : | instability, unstableness, |
| definition | : | the quality or attribute of being unstable and irresolute (noun.attribute) |
| derivation | : | stable, |
| definition | : | firm and dependable; subject to little fluctuation (adj.all) |
| derivation | : | stable, |
| definition | : | resistant to change of position or condition (adj.all) |
